Theory of Constraints - A method for bringing about continuous improvement

 Movie Notes

TOC Steps

  1. Identify the Bottleneck/constraint
  2. Exploit the Bottleneck/binding constraint
  3. Subordinate everything else to the decision made in step #2
  4. Elevate the binding constraint/Bottleneck
  5. Go to step #1

Throughput – the rate at which an organization generates money through SALES

(Throughput = Sales – Unit level variable costs.  Direct Labor is treated as fixed.)

Inventory is all of the money the company spends turning materials into throughput.

Operating expenses are defined as the money the organization spends to turn inventory into throughput.
